Embark Plus ADA Paratransit Service is a transportation program tailored to meet the needs of individuals with disabilities or limitations that prevent them from using traditional public transportation. This program offers convenient paratransit services at a cost ranging from $3 to $6, making it an accessible option for older adults seeking reliable transportation within their community.
Participants in the Embark Plus ADA Paratransit Service can enjoy the flexibility of scheduling shared rides via bus or train, providing a comfortable and accommodating travel experience. To utilize this program, riders are required to book their trips a few days in advance, ensuring that their transportation needs are met promptly and efficiently.
With a focus on inclusivity and accessibility, Embark Plus ADA Paratransit Service offers curb-to-curb transportation, prioritizing the safety and convenience of older adults with diverse mobility requirements. Payments for this program can be made in cash or by check, providing older adults with flexibility in managing their transportation expenses effectively. Service Area
3/4 mile past fixed route bus system in Metro OKC
